Delhi Rent Agreement Registration: A Process and Requirements

Formalizing your tenancy contract is a mandatory legal step. This process, governed by Delhi’s laws, ensures legal enforceability for both landlord and tenant . Below is a breakdown of a required steps and essential documents. First, parties must sign the agreement itself. Then, you need to visit a Sub-Registrar’s Office (SRO) with original agreement and supporting paperwork. The following documents typically include:

  • Identity documents for landlord and tenant – such as Aadhaar card, PAN card, copyright
  • Address documents – copyright
  • Original property deed/title paperwork
  • Witnesses – generally two individuals above 18 years of age.
  • Stamp duty – which varies the amount of lease agreement.

Failure to register can result in fines and challenges in enforcing the agreement. Therefore to continue with registration soon. For additional details, consult Delhi government’s portal or talk to a legal professional .

Lease Agreement Registration: Legal Aspects in Delhi & Dwarka Mor

Registering your tenancy deed in Delhi, particularly in areas like Dwarka Mor, is a required judicial formality. The Delhi Rent Control Act, together with the Registration Act of 1908, dictates the method. While technically not strictly enforced everywhere, registering the document offers considerable protection against disagreements and provides validation of the stipulations agreed upon by both the owner and the renter . Failing to register can potentially lead to difficulties in tribunals should any matter arise later. It’s always recommended to consult with a local attorney to ensure adherence with the existing rules and regulations pertaining to property registration in Dwarka Mor and Delhi.
